Other reasons why Floorplans are crucial when building a custom Texas barndominium, particularly for a few Texas-specific reasons and general barndominium design considerations. Here’s a breakdown of why they’re so important in your Texas barndominium project:
Optimizing for Texas Climate:
Heat and Sun:
Texas summers are brutal. A well-designed floorplan can strategically position living spaces, windows, and outdoor areas to minimize direct sun exposure during the hottest parts of the day, helping to keep the interior cool naturally. This can be achieved through proper orientation, overhangs, and window placement detailed in the floorplan.
Ventilation and Airflow:
Texas can be humid. Floorplans should maximize natural ventilation through strategic window and door placement, promoting cross-breezes that help regulate temperature and humidity. Open-concept barndominium designs often excel at this, but proper planning in the floorplan is still key.
Rain and Storms:
Texas experiences heavy rainfall and occasional severe storms. The floorplan can incorporate features like porches, covered walkways, and mudrooms to provide transition spaces between the outdoors and indoors, minimizing the amount of water and debris tracked inside.
Land Orientation:
The Texas sun is intense. The floorplan will dictate how your barndominium is situated on your land to take advantage of natural shade, prevailing winds, and views while minimizing direct sunlight exposure.
Barndominium-Specific Considerations:
Open Concept Living:
Barndominiums are known for their large, open living spaces. Floorplans are essential to define different zones within this open space (kitchen, dining, living) while maintaining a sense of flow and spaciousness.
Loft Spaces:
Many barndominiums incorporate lofts. Floorplans meticulously plan the placement, access (stairs/ladder), headroom, and safety features of these lofts.
Multi-Functionality:
Barndominiums often have spaces that serve multiple purposes (e.g., a large great room that doubles as an entertainment area). Floorplans are crucial to ensure these spaces are adaptable and functional for their various uses.
Shop/Garage Integration:
A defining feature of many barndominiums is the integration of a large garage or workshop. The floorplan needs to consider the flow between these spaces and the living areas, ensuring proper separation for noise, fumes, and traffic.
